Cloud sat in Jadorin's lap, purring contentedly as he pet her. He knew
Lymria had seen the feline in his workroom but they hadn't discussed the
fact that both he and Cloud would be moving in with her after their marriage.
Of course, Tini would be too, but the firelizard didn't take up as much room
as the feline, and Cloud seemed to shed constantly. He hoped that
wouldn't be a strain on the marriage. The relationship already had more
than its fair share of pressure.
He forced his thoughts back to the present, and the blank hide in front of
him. He had procrastinated long enough and now, the day before his
wedding, he could not put it off any longer.
Putting pen to paper, he began writing a letter to his parents, his neat script
belying the jumble of emotions he had been experiencing for sevendays.
[Dear Mother and Father,
I apologize for not writing for several months. I have been very busy with
a number of commissions. I also have important news to tell you.
Tomorrow I will be getting married. Her name is Lymria. She is a
wonderful woman and I'm sure you love her from the moment you meet
her.
The situation is a bit complicated. She has two fosterlings and a young
son from a previous marriage. And, although we have not told anyone
else, she is now pregnant with my child. Don't blame her for any of this.
I am to blame. And, please keep the news to yourself for now.
We won't be able to visit until after she gives birth, but I promise you will
be able to meet everyone in a few months. I know this all must come as a
shock for you, but I hope you will accept Lymria and her children into our
family.
I hope everything is going well there. Please give my regards to everyone.
Jadorin]
Reading over the final draft, he wondered if he was being too apologetic, or
if he should break the news more gently. But, in the end he decided to
send the letter without any changes. Tini was always happy to deliver a
message to his parents because she knew she would be fed plenty as well
as given a lot of attention. In fact, he only trusted her to send messages to
them. Whenever he tried to send the green anywhere else she either
became confused and refused to budge or disappeared /between/ and
ended up at his parents' anyway.
As he awaited their reply Jadorin gently moved Cloud from his lap and
checked his closet for his wedding garment. It was hanging on a hook,
ready for the following day. He wondered if he should have taken the
time to make a new suit but the one he already had would do, and there
had been little time to prepare for this. The advantage of a rushed
wedding was that there was little time to do much of anything.
The day she had told him of the pregnancy, when they had decided to get
married, he had gone to his room, sat down on the bed, and thought for
almost a candlemark. Once he had convinced himself that this _was_ the
best decision and that he _could_ do this, albeit after freaking out for a
few minutes, he hadn't let himself rethink the decision. As far as he was
concerned, from that moment, his future was set in stone.
He and Lymria had spent some time together over the past few sevendays
but he still felt like he hardly knew her, and was definitely not comfortable
yet with her children. The youngest would be the easiest, but Torgny
would probably take some time to adjust. Jadorin himself did not know
how long it would be before he would feel at home in his new life, or would
even feel like he was in reality, rather than some strange dream. Maybe
some day he would even look forward to going home from the workshop
to be with his family. Maybe. At least, he hoped so.
